Promoters of bafna pharmaceuticals have confirmed that no shares of the company were encumbered during the financial year ended March 31, 2026. The disclosures were submitted to the stock exchanges in compliance with Regulation 31(4) of the SEBI (Substantial Acquisition of Shares and Takeovers) Regulations, 2011. This regulatory filing ensures transparency regarding the pledging or hypothecation of promoter holdings.

Bafna Mahaveer Chand, a promoter of the company, declared on behalf of the Promoter and Promoter Group that no encumbrance of shares was made directly or indirectly in FY26. The confirmation was addressed to BSE Limited and the National Stock Exchange of India Limited. The company’s scrip codes are 532989 on the BSE and BAFNAPH on the NSE.

SRJR Lifesciences LLP, also identified as a promoter, submitted a separate declaration confirming that it did not create any encumbrance over the shares held by the firm during the same period. The disclosure was signed by Upendar Mekala Reddy, Designated Partner of SRJR Lifesciences LLP. The entity provided its LLPIN as AAR-4517.

The following table summarizes the key details of the disclosures:

Entity Role Declaration Period Regulation
Bafna Mahaveer Chand Promoter FY ended March 31, 2026 SEBI (Substantial Acquisition of Shares & Takeovers) Regulations, 2011
SRJR Lifesciences LLP Promoter FY ended March 31, 2026 SEBI (Substantial Acquisition of Shares & Takeovers) Regulations, 2011

The submissions were made to the exchanges on April 4, 2026, and April 1, 2026, respectively. Copies of the disclosures were also marked to the Audit Committee and the Company Secretary of Bafna Pharmaceuticals Limited. The company’s registered office is located in Chennai, Tamil Nadu.

Bafna Pharmaceuticals Limited accepted the retirement of Mr. Navin Kumar as an Independent Director upon the completion of his first term effective June 22, 2026. Consequently, he ceased to be the Chairman of the Audit Committee and the Nomination & Remuneration Committee. The Board has reconstituted these committees effective June 23, 2026, to ensure continued compliance with applicable laws.

Pursuant to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, the company informed the exchanges regarding the change. Mr. Navin Kumar's retirement took effect at the close of business hours on June 22, 2026. The company confirmed that despite this change, the composition of the Board and its Committees remains in compliance with regulatory requirements.

The reconstituted Audit Committee is chaired by Mr. Palamadai Krishnan Sundaresan. Members include Mrs. Ravichandran Chitra and Mr. Upendar Mekala Reddy. The Nomination and Remuneration Committee is also chaired by Mr. Palamadai Krishnan Sundaresan, with Mrs. Ravichandran Chitra and Mrs. Akila Chintalapati Raju serving as members.

The disclosures were made in accordance with Regulation 30 of the S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015 read with SEBI Master Circular No. HO/49/14/14(7)2025-CFD-POD2/I/3762/2026 dated January 30, 2026. Mr. Navin Kumar's Director Identification Number (DIN) is 08778662.

Reconstituted Board Committees

Name of the Committee Name of the Director Designation & Category
Audit Committee Mr. Palamadai Krishnan Sundaresan Chairman (Non-Executive, Independent)
Mrs. Ravichandran Chitra Member (Non-Executive, Independent)
Mr. Upendar Mekala Reddy Member (Non-Executive, Non-Independent)
Nomination and Remuneration Committee Mr. Palamadai Krishnan Sundaresan Chairman (Non-Executive, Independent)
Mrs. Ravichandran Chitra Member (Non-Executive, Independent)
Mrs. Akila Chintalapati Raju Member (Non-Executive, Non-Independent)
